Unraveling the NDIS Framework
The National Disability Insurance Scheme offers a robust framework for tailored support. From funding for necessary aids to facilitating community engagement, NDIS aims to enhance the quality of life for participants.
Prioritizing Mental Wellbeing: A Personalized Approach
Embracing Therapeutic Techniques
Therapeutic interventions play a pivotal role in managing mental health. Engaging in counselling, cognitive-behavioural therapy, or art therapy can provide individuals with effective tools to cope with challenges.
Nurturing Supportive Networks
Building a strong support system is crucial. From family and friends to support groups, fostering connections contributes significantly to mental health. NDIS can assist in creating a supportive network tailored to individual needs.
Strategies for Enhancing Daily Living
Adaptive Technologies: Empowering Independence
Leveraging adaptive technologies can significantly enhance daily living for individuals with disabilities. From smart home devices to specialized apps, these tools empower independence and efficiency.
Personalized Wellness Plans
Crafting personalized wellness plans ensures that individuals receive targeted support. NDIS facilitates the creation of these plans, addressing unique needs and goals, and promoting a proactive approach to mental health.
